Another COE auction today, not quite the $50 a pound of brazil but the money was much more spread out and actually made more for the farmers than that brazil one.

I actually prefer to see this spread out bidding than top heavy, but it was tough going bidding. Lost out on the one I wanted as my budget went, but as always a back up plan meant I got still got great coffee.

To put it in persepctive the fair trade price is $1.26 and the market price around $1.10 and thats with middle men.
